The Beauty of Connections Through Hope and Innovation
Caroline Geys, 2026
The Beauty of Connections Through Hope and Innovation was created by Caroline Geys for the City of Hope Orange County.
This mural is inspired by connections of innovation, resilience and community that we carry with us every day. The organic shapes and shades of colors emulate optimism and hope that illuminate new paths forward. The mural becomes a celebration of creativity, discovery and the power of bright ideas.
Belgian-born and based in Los Angeles’ Arts District, Caroline Geys is a multidisciplinary artist whose work moves fluidly between muralism, fine art and vector digital art. Her practice is driven by an exploration of optimism, color and the interplay between natural and built environments, often referencing topography, nostalgia and architectural form. Working across multiple mediums simultaneously, she brings a dynamic sense of momentum to her work. Within this project, her compositions evoke a layered evolving landscape shaped by both memory and possibility.
“Hope is a Rising Tide,” is a large-scale public art installation presented by City of Hope Orange County in partnership with Lido Marina Village. This outdoor gallery transforms the destination’s parking structure into a vibrant, walkable art experience featuring works from from 11 Southern California artists, including one cancer survivor. Each piece reflects themes of hope and healing, creating a curated collection designed to uplift and inspire visitors. As the first and last touchpoint for more than one million visitors each year, the structure now carries more than arrivals and departures. It carries a story rooted in momentum, resilience, and community strength.
